sql server备份以及还原的命令操作

  • Post author:
  • Post category:其他




SQL Server Management Studio备份和还原数据库的操作

环境:windows10、已经部署好sql server 2008 R2、能成功连接到数据库;

在这里插入图片描述

在这里插入图片描述

例如:备份class1数据库

BACKUP DATABASE [class1] TO  DISK = N'D:\program files\sql server\MSSQLSERVER\MSSQL10_50.MSSQLSERVER\MSSQL\Backup\class1.bak' WITH NOFORMAT, NOINIT,  NAME = N'class1-完整 数据库 备份', SKIP, NOREWIND, NOUNLOAD,  STATS = 10
GO

在这里插入图片描述

备份日志

BACKUP LOG [class1] TO  DISK = N'D:\program files\sql server\MSSQLSERVER\MSSQL10_50.MSSQLSERVER\MSSQL\Backup\class2.bak' WITH NOFORMAT, NOINIT,  NAME = N'class1-事务日志  备份', SKIP, NOREWIND, NOUNLOAD,  STATS = 10
GO

在这里插入图片描述

还原

RESTORE DATABASE [class1] FROM  DISK = N'D:\program files\sql server\MSSQLSERVER\MSSQL10_50.MSSQLSERVER\MSSQL\Backup\class2.bak' WITH  FILE = 1,  NOUNLOAD,  STATS = 10
GO

在这里插入图片描述



版权声明:本文为HelloWorld_4396原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。